Installing the New Version


When the current application version is upgraded with a new release, it is important to follow the steps below. 
   
  If you already logged in to the application, 

(1) The "New Version is Initializing" message will appear on your application. 

(2) You will be redirected to the login page automatically. 

(3) You may log in to the application with your credentials and continue the work.

   Log in to the application for the first time, 

(1) The "New Version is Initializing" message will appear on your application.

(2) You may log in to the application with your credentials and continue the work.

If your device fails to initialize the new version, then the application will try for 1 to 5 attempts to download the new version.

Even after the 5th attempt, if the application still does not download, please consult your system administrator and contact the Q2 Solutions Client Success team for further assistance.


Start and Stop Work on each Work Order

Your employees will be able to start work on a specific work request or planned work order and stop work on the same work request or planned work order.  This allows for improved reporting and job tracking.  The ‘start’ and ‘stop’ functions allow for multiple people on the same job, and multiple times on the same job.

Manually Added Material on Work Orders

Material can be added directly to work requests and planned work via the “Manual Entry” option now available in the drop-down list on the Update and Complete screens. This allows you to quickly add all spare parts and material to work, without the overhead of creating it in inventory items first.

The functionality is different depending on if you have the Inventory module or not have the Inventory module.

Contractors Recorded Separately on Work Orders 


You now have the ability to record contractors on Work Requests using the mobile. This can be done when updating or completing the work request. Similarly, you can also record contractors on Planned Work using the mobile when updating or completing the planned work.

Improvements to Work request submission -Icon Navigation


Icons are now automatically hidden based on new rules.  This means the user will only select icons that lead to a successful new work request submission.

Editing a Work Request with Automatic Notifications


Users with appropriate privileges have the power to make corrections to a submitted work request. This means you can fix any mistakes and ensure that the request is accurate and up-to-date. Editing a work request will re-submit the work request, which means the software will allocate the request according to the allocation rules.

New Planned Work Orders on Desktop(New menu)

The Planned Work Order list has been added to Desktop (previously only on Mobile) and has been enhanced significantly to allow for full management of Planned Work Orders from a single page. The existing Planned Work Calendar, Room View, and Multiple Actions pages also remain.

To-Do List(New menu)

The new To-Do List provides a single area where multiple operational items may be viewed and actioned. The To-Do list is automatically filtered for work allocated to the logged-in user on both desktop and mobile views.

FAQ changed to Knowledgebase


The FAQ  section has been updated to open the Knowledgebase with the latest information. You can also easily reach our support team via chat - directly accessible through this channel.
